树莓派学习笔记(一)

来源:互联网 发布:windows gvim配置模板 编辑:程序博客网 时间:2024/05/16 06:47

1.树莓派介绍

Raspberry Pi(中文名为“树莓派”,简写为RPi,(或者RasPi / RPI) 是为学生计算机编程教育而设计,只有信用卡大小的微型电脑,其系统基于Linux。 随着Windows 10 IoT的发布,我们也将可以用上运行Windows的树莓派。 自问世以来,受众多计算机发烧友和创客的追捧,曾经一“派”难求。别看其外表“娇小”,内“心”却很强大,视频、音频等功能通通皆有,可谓是“麻雀虽小,五脏俱全”。——百度百科

树莓派可以说是一个小型的电脑主机。

2.主流树莓派种类

市面上基本为以下两种:

  • B型:2个USB、支持有线网络、功率3.5W,700mA、512MB RAM、26个GPIO

  • B+型:4个USB口、支持有线网络,功耗1W,512M RAM 40个GPIO

我使用的是B+型
这里写图片描述

3.树莓派开机

树莓派开发板没有配置板载FLASH,因为它支持SD卡启动,所有我们需要下载相应镜像,并将其烧写在SD上,启动系统即可。树莓派由于其开源特性,支持非常多的系统类型(指的文件系统)

树莓派镜像下载

http://www.raspberrypi.org/
官网(速度较慢)

http://pan.baidu.com/share/home?uk=671504480#category/type=0
树莓派论坛提供的下载地址 (百度网盘速度较快)

https://pan.baidu.com/s/1pKhlIIZ 博主用的系统
Raspbain jesssi:树莓派官方力推系统,也是最主流的系统,基于debian,最新Linux内核版本为4.1,可图形界面。

此外我们还需要一个辅助软件来往TF卡中烧入系统

系统镜像写入工具——Win32DiskImager
下载地址 https://sourceforge.net/projects/win32diskimager/

开始烧写镜像

准备:
1)一张2G以上的SD卡及读卡器,最好是高速卡,推荐Class4以上的卡,卡的速度直接影响树莓派的运行速度
最好4G以上,否则后续开发会使用经常不够用

2)winXP和win7下安装镜像的工具:Win32DiskImager.zip

3)下载好的镜像

安装:
1)解压下载的系统压缩文件,得到img镜像文件

2)将SD使用卡托或者读卡器后,连上电脑

3)解压并运行win32diskimager工具

这里写图片描述

4)在软件中选择img文件,“Device”下选择SD的盘符,然后选择“Write”
然后就开始安装系统了,根据你的SD速度,安装过程有快有慢。

5)安装结束后会弹出完成对话框,说明安装就完成了,如果不成功,请关闭防火墙一类的软件,重新插入SD进行安装
请注意安装完,win系统下看到SD只有74MB了,这是正常现象,因为linux下的分区win下是看不到的!

然后就可以开机啦。

4. 外接显示器

树莓派提供hdmi接口外接显示器,直接接线即可。

阅读其他教程发现也可使用USB转ttl 串口线通过串口访问树莓派。
参考http://blog.csdn.net/xdw1985829/article/details/38779827

博主用的是3.5inch_RPi_LCD_(B)的LCD显示屏。
这里写图片描述

这里写图片描述

该显示屏只能通过GPIO接口来进行连接,而且需要在系统中预装驱动程序。
驱动程序下载地址 http://www.waveshare.net/wiki/3.5inch_RPi_LCD_(B)

1) 将镜像文件下载到电脑上,并解压得到.img文件。

2) 将TF卡连接到电脑,打开Win32DiskImager.exe软件,选择第1步准备的.img文件,点击write烧写镜像。

3) 烧写完成后,将树莓派LCD驱动复制到TF卡根目录(也可以用U盘或网络将驱动文件复制到镜像的文件系统中)保存并安全弹出TF卡。

4) 启动树莓派,登录树莓派的终端(可以将树莓派接到HDMI显示器或用ssh远程登录)

5) 前面已经把树莓派驱动复制到/boot目录下, 执行以下操作:
tar xzvf /boot/LCD-show-YYMMDD.tar.gz
cd LCD-show/
./LCD35B-show

重启后即可使用。

0 0
原创粉丝点击